How do we define a Fixed Width Format for a Target File?
What all options do we select?

One of the sequential file settings is for fixed width output, then make sure you don't have any VarChar() columns.

The easiest way is while importing the table definition of that file (assuming it exists) or creating the table definition (assuming it doesn't exist). Record the width of each field, which is stored in the Display Width field.

Its currently throwing these errors:
1)Error when checking operator: Unable to initialize the exporter.
or
Error when checking operator: Export validation failed.
2)Error when checking operator: "record_length=fixed" (no length given) and record field format is variable-length. The first variable-length field is "cust_name".
3)Error when checking operator: At field "cust_state": "null_length" may only be used in conjunction with prefix length or link length
Error when checking operator: At field "rating": "null_length" may only be used in conjunction with prefix length or link length
Error when checking operator: At field "numb": "null_length" may only be used in conjunction with prefix length or link length
The source has datatype Varchar, but in the file, while importing metadata, I changed Varchar to char.
Any solution?
